Output 34acfa80f9f693cf525d9e15069ded4bc167b35e3aca27e2e5ebe7cb5b5baade:0
- value
- 2174486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 512fdcaece437957fae67510ed8e098050c561e0 OP_EQUAL
- address
- 396HzbTtvhkatMuSpESp8myFFPdQLMLvaT
- transaction
- 34acfa80f9f693cf525d9e15069ded4bc167b35e3aca27e2e5ebe7cb5b5baade
- confirmations
- 276396
- spent
- true